Reference excerpt

Reality is the totality of existence or what all existing entities have in common. It is often contrasted with appearance, opposing what is with what seems to be, although the accuracy and fundamentality of this contrast are disputed. Various criteria for distinguishing real from unreal entities have been proposed, including causal powers, mind-independence, and being non-illusory. The concept of reality overlaps with notions such as being, existence, world, actuality, and truth. Debates about the constituents and structure of reality ask what kinds of things there are and how they are organized. Proposed constituents include particulars and universals, concrete and abstract objects, facts, events, and elementary particles. Structural questions address the relation between parts and wholes, the distinction between fundamental and non-fundamental entities, the idea that reality forms a hierarchy of levels, and the roles of unity and multiplicity in monist–pluralist debates. Other discussions examine space and time as frameworks that organize relations among entities, and laws of nature describing regularities or general patterns of how entities interact and changes unfold. Realism is the view that reality does not depend on human knowledge or consciousness and exists apart from them. Anti-realism, by contrast, holds that certain aspects of reality depend on mental processes, subjective perspectives, or social conventions. Debates between realists and anti-realists span multiple domains, addressing the objective existence of universals, abstract objects, values, and unobservable entities posited by scientific theories. A related topic concerns the possibility and limits of knowledge as a successful cognitive contact with reality. Contemporary technology in the form of augmented and virtual reality can inform experience and raises questions about the ontological status of virtual objects. The concept of reality is relevant to many fields, including metaphysics, epistemology, physics, psychology, and anthropology. Theories of the nature of reality have been discussed since antiquity and continue to shape contemporary inquiry, with influential early traditions originating in ancient Indian, Chinese, and Greek thought.

Definition Reality is the totality of existing entities. It encompasses the whole cosmos and everything within it, including rocks, trees, humans, and stars. In a slightly different sense, reality is not the totality itself but an aspect shared by all its constituents. In this sense, it is the state of being real or what all real entities have in common, separating them from unreal or illusory ones. When used as a countable noun, the expression a reality denotes a specific domain or coherent, interconnected framework, such as the social reality of a particular culture or the virtual reality of a specific video game world. Reality is often contrasted with appearance: appearance is how things seem to be, while reality is how they in fact are. It is controversial whether this contrast marks a genuine and fundamental difference between an experienced realm of appearances and an inaccessible realm of reality. Another outlook holds that appearance and reality are different ways of considering the same being, locating the difference in the conceptual framing rather than a division of worlds. This view is consistent with the idea that accurate appearances show things as they are, suggesting that appearance and reality can align and are not necessarily distinct. Both accurate and inaccurate appearances may themselves be part of reality, for instance as brain events, according to one suggestion. Real entities are typically taken to exist on their own, independent of what people think about them. When a person encounters them, their appearances may reveal only some features while leaving others hidden. Whereas appearances can be vague, as in a blurry vision, it is often suggested that reality is fully determinate or fixed in all details. The word reality comes from the Latin term realitas, rooted in the word res, meaning 'thing', and from the French term réalité. Its earliest known use in English dates to the early 1500s. The concept of reality is relevant to many fields, including metaphysics, a branch of philosophy that studies the nature and fundamental structure of reality, and the empirical sciences, which examine the constituents and laws of the natural world through observation and experimentation.
